Course Content

• Welfare State Economics and Financing
• Measuring Poverty and Inequality (Poverty Measurement, Gini Coefficient)
• Program Evaluation Methodologies: Quantitative and Qualitative Approaches (Impact Evaluation, Randomized Controlled Trials, Qualitative Data Analysis)
• Welfare State Reforms and Institutional Design
• The Political Economy of Welfare State Change
• Social Program Implementation and Service Delivery
• Data Analysis for Welfare State Evaluation (Regression Analysis, Statistical Software)
• Ethical Considerations in Welfare State Research
• Communicating Evaluation Findings to Policymakers (Policy Brief Writing, Presentation Skills)

Career Role Description
Welfare State Policy Analyst (Primary: Policy, Secondary: Analysis) Researching and evaluating the impact of welfare policies, offering data-driven recommendations for improvement. High demand in government and think tanks.
Social Welfare Program Manager (Primary: Program, Secondary: Management) Overseeing the implementation and evaluation of social welfare programs. Requires strong organizational and leadership skills. Excellent job security.
Welfare Benefit Claims Assessor (Primary: Assessment, Secondary: Benefits) Processing and assessing welfare benefit claims, ensuring compliance with regulations. Involves detailed casework and attention to detail.
Social Work Researcher (Primary: Research, Secondary: Social Work) Conducting research to inform welfare policies, often focusing on specific vulnerable populations. Strong analytical and communication skills are crucial.
